ELMR Earnings Per Share Analysis

El Mor's Earnings per Share (EPS) denotes the portion of a company's earnings that is allocated to each share of common stock. To calculate Earnings per Share investors will need to take a company's net income, subtract any dividends for preferred stock, and divide it by the number of average outstanding shares. EPS is usually presented in two different ways: basic and diluted. Fully diluted Earnings per Share takes into account effects of warrants, options, and convertible securities and is generally viewed by analysts as a more accurate measure.

El-Mor Electric Installation Services Ltd. operates in the energy, infrastructure, and communications fields in Israel and internationally. As of May 3, 2017, El-Mor Electric Installation Services Ltd. is a subsidiary of Rapac Communication Infrastructure Ltd. ELMORE ELEC is traded on Tel Aviv Stock Exchange in Israel.

The correlation of El Mor is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as El Mor mo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if El-Mor Electric Inst mo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
